Both ERU and FSI are excellent schools and will train you well. However, have you considered a school like ATP or moving to the states and going to a well respected FBO? You'll spend $35k vs $70-100k, won't be in debt the rest of your life and will come out with the same licenses.

Yes, I believe ATP is a very good school and will cost you considerably less than other schools.

Bottom line....if you have $50k+ to spend, go to DCA, FSI, etc....

If you have $35k to spend go to ATP, Ari Ben, etc....

By a BA degree I assume you're talking about a Bachelor's degree? If you go to a state school it will run you about $30k-40k including room and board. If you go to a private school it can easily run up to $100k.

I would do your bachelors degree before and if possible during your flight training. Without the degree, your chances at an airline career are slim to none. If I were you, I would concentrate on the degree right now and try to squeeze in flight training during the summer at some local flight schools.
